The Debates of the Legislative Assembly
When the Legislative Assembly is in session, every word spoken by a member is faithfully transcribed, and published in a document called a Hansard. Currently, we've indexed Hansards from the Legislative Assembly dating back to 1991. Browse through them below, or search via the box above.
